Deed operates as a sophisticated workplace giving and volunteering platform designed to bridge the gap between corporate objectives and individual employee impact. The platform offers a comprehensive suite of enterprise social impact software, enabling organizations to manage Employee Engagement, ESG initiatives, and Workplace Philanthropy with seamless efficiency. By providing tools for Employee Giving, Volunteering, and Grants, Deed empowers a global workforce to contribute time, money, and talent to causes that resonate with their personal values.

The platform is engineered to foster a culture of purpose, utilizing innovative technology to drive DEIB (Diversity, Equity, Inclusion, and Belonging) outcomes. Through its user-friendly interface, Deed transforms traditional CSR programs into dynamic, community-driven experiences, ensuring that social impact is accessible, measurable, and scalable for enterprises of all sizes.

How much funding has Deed raised?

Deed has raised a total of $2.1M across 2 funding rounds:

2020

Angel/Seed

$2M

2021

Debt

$109K

Angel/Seed (2020): $2M with participation from Paua Ventures and Farzad Khostowshahi

Debt (2021): $109K led by PPP
